Not bad at all, according to one former call girl for the recently busted mother-of-four madam. “Lizzie” tells the Daily News today that Anna Gristina ran a tight ship, but she also compensated well, taking a 40 percent cut, apparently low in the industry. A weekend abroad could run a client — allegedly including politicians, CEOs, and royalty — $25,000, while the hourly rate at the East 78th Street headquarters was at least $800, plus tips. It wasn’t a job for everyone: “My friend, she [was] rejected just because she was a little overweight — just 5 pounds,” Lizzie said. “You have to stay in really good shape when you work for Anna. I worked out.” The cash, she said, was stored in the microwave, so at least Hot Pockets weren’t a problem.
